Former Texas quarterback Hudson Card made the reports official Monday evening; He will officially be transferring to Purdue.
That’s a huge get for the Boilermakers, who will be losing Aidan O’Connell after this season to the NFL Draft. Purdue will go on without O’Connell against LSU in the Citrus Bowl.

Card played well for the Texas Longhorns this season. He’s best known for coming in and playing well for injured QB Quinn Ewers against Alabama, taking the Longhorns to the doorstep against the Crimson Tide. Alabama went on to win, 31-29.
Card played in 6 games this season for Texas, throwing for 928 yards, 6 touchdowns and 1 interception as a backup option. He entered the transfer portal looking for an opportunity such as Purdue’s, and now he’s set to be the QB of the future in West Lafayette.
He will have 2 seasons of eligibility remaining.
